A young actor's stormy childhood and early adult years as he struggles to reconcile with his father and deal with his mental health.

It is hard to watch somebody just wanting to be loved and then in return is ignored and abused. The actors playing Shia do a great job with Noah Jupe being the best acting part. It does kinda just feel like a therapy session though and the movie left me wanting more answers to things. It’s solid watch and a look behind the curtain of Shias life.
